They can access good children's online stories through various platforms. Many libraries have online platforms where they can borrow e - books which include children's stories. Some popular reading apps like Epic! also offer a wide range of children's stories for free or with a subscription. Additionally, some children's book publishers have their own websites where they showcase their stories.
Children can access children's online stories safely by using filtered search engines. These search engines are designed to block inappropriate content. Additionally, parents can download specific children's story apps from reliable sources such as the official app stores. Before allowing children to use an app or website, parents should read the privacy policy to ensure that the child's data will be protected. It's also a good idea to have conversations with children about online safety so that they know what to look out for when accessing stories.

To access Alexa children's stories, first make sure your Alexa device is connected to the internet. Then, you can use voice commands like 'Alexa, tell me a children's story' or you can go to the Alexa app on your mobile device. In the app, there may be a section dedicated to children's stories where you can select and play the ones you like.
